Anthony Young Listed By Rivals As "Instant Impact JUCO Player"
Rivals has listed it's ten "Instant Impact JUCO Players" and Iowa State's Anthony Young is listed among them.
Two other Big 12 JUCO transfers are listed. They are Jermarcus Hardrick (OT) of Nebraska and Malcolm Murray (DB) of Oklahoma State.
Of personal interest to me is Jakar Hamilton of Georgia. I had the privilege of watching this young man this past September when Georgia Military Academy played Ellsworth. Hamilton single-handidly turned the tide of the game towards Georgia Military Academy with a "pick six" in the fourth quarter. I had read about him in some of my pre-game preparation, but when I saw him on the field I was amazed. From what I saw, there is no doubt in my mind we'll be reading about him a lot over the next couple of years.
